[SWITCH] Ultrahand Overlay 1.8.4: Aggiornamento di Stabilità e Nuove Funzionalità

Ultrahand Overlay, il potente sostituto di Tesla Menu basato su libtesla, ha appena ricevuto un nuovo aggiornamento alla versione 1.8.4, focalizzato su miglioramenti alla stabilità e correzioni di bug. Questo strumento avanzato permette di eseguire comandi personalizzati in C/C++ grazie a un linguaggio di programmazione interpretato simile a Shell/BASH, offrendo un controllo senza precedenti sulla gestione di file, directory e configurazioni del tuo Nintendo Switch.


Novità in Ultrahand Overlay 1.8.4

Correzioni di Bug e Miglioramenti

  • Miglioramenti alla rilevazione di combinazioni pericolose (isDangerousCombination)
    Alcuni pattern con wildcard venivano erroneamente segnalati come pericolosi. Questa versione risolve il problema, garantendo una maggiore precisione.

  • Fix per i comandi “Enable All” e “Disable All” in Mod Alchemist
    Ora funzionano correttamente nell’ambito di exeFS Groups.

  • Risolti problemi con gli placeholder ./ in ScriptOverlay
    I percorsi relativi non venivano sostituiti correttamente con la cartella del pacchetto.

  • Miglioramenti al sistema di logging
    Il file di log predefinito è ora impostato su sdmc:/switch/.packages/log.txt quando il logging è attivo.

Modifiche alle funzioni di conversione esadecimale

Sono state apportate modifiche a decimalToHex in libultra, permettendo di specificare manualmente l’ordine dei byte:

  • order 2 → XX

  • order 4 → XXXX

  • order 6 → XXXXXX

  • (e così via…)

Se non specificato, l’ordine predefinito è 2, ma verrà automaticamente adattato in base al valore decimale se maggiore.

Nuovi comandi disponibili:

hex-by-custom-decimal-offset <file_path> <custom_pattern> <offset> <decimal_data> [optional_order]
hex-by-custom-rdecimal-offset <file_path> <custom_pattern> <offset> <rdecimal_data> [optional_order]
hex-by-decimal <file_path> <decimal_data_to_replace> <decimal_data_replacement> [optional_order] [optional_occurrence]
hex-by-rdecimal <file_path> <decimal_data_to_replace> <decimal_data_replacement> [optional_order] [optional_occurrence]

Nota: Per usare optional_occurrence, è necessario specificare prima optional_order.


Ripristinata la funzionalità “@disabled” in pchtxt

A causa dell’eliminazione della Pull Request #5 in libultrahand, la funzionalità @disabled in pchtxt è stata ripristinata per garantire la massima compatibilità con i mod esistenti.

🔗 Changelog completo: v1.8.3…v1.8.4
🔗 Ultimo aggiornamento: v1.8.4…0ad6580


Cos’è Ultrahand Overlay?

Ultrahand Overlay è un sostituto avanzato di Tesla Menu, sviluppato da zero utilizzando libtesla, che offre un linguaggio di scripting personalizzato per eseguire comandi complessi direttamente dal menu overlay del Nintendo Switch.

Con Ultrahand, puoi:
✅ Creare, copiare, spostare ed eliminare file e cartelle
✅ Scaricare ed estrarre archivi ZIP
✅ Modificare file INI e HEX direttamente
✅ Convertire mod da pchtxt a IPS/cheats
✅ Eseguire comandi di sistema (spegnimento, reboot, gestione controller Bluetooth)
✅ Automatizzare operazioni all’avvio con boot_package.ini


Come Installare Ultrahand Overlay

  1. Scarica e installa l’ultima versione di nxovloader.

  2. Posiziona ovlmenu.ovl in /switch/.overlays/ (sostituirà Tesla Menu se già installato)

  3. Avvia Ultrahand con la combinazione di tasti predefinita (ZL+ZR+DDOWN)

  4. Crea i tuoi pacchetti personalizzati in /switch/.packages/<NOME_PACCHETTO>/package.ini

📌 Suggerimento: Se un pacchetto non viene visualizzato, prova a eseguire “Fix Bit Archive” in Hekate.


Funzionalità Avanzate

  • Premi A → Esegui un comando

  • Premi - (MINUS) → Visualizza le righe di comando

  • Premi + (PLUS) → Menu delle impostazioni

  • Premi X → Aggiungi un overlay ai preferiti

  • Premi Y → Configurazione avanzata

🔍 Per maggiori dettagli, consulta la Wiki ufficiale.


Scarica Ultrahand Overlay 1.8.4

📥 GitHub Repository

Hai domande o problemi? Unisciti alla community e condividi le tue esperienze! 🚀

Da FRANCESCO

Sviluppatore a tempo perso nato negli anni 80, amante delle console e delle retro console.Il mio motto è quello di aiutare il prossimo senza avere rimorsi di cio' che hai fatto.

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*

Questo sito utilizza Akismet per ridurre lo spam. Scopri come vengono elaborati i dati derivati dai commenti.